1) COMMUNICATION SKILLS
The ability to read, write and speak clearly and effectively is the most important soft skill, especially in the Job environment. Many projects, though they have good ideas, fail because of poor communication or presentation.

3) INTERPERSONAL RELATIONSHIPS
The ability to teach and create an environment of trust, empathy, and respect is an asset to a professional. If they can work side by side with others and provide mentoring and support, they become effective in their field. The most important quality is the willingness to share and listen and be patient with others as they work with others.

6) EFFECTIVE PROBLEM-SOLVING SKILLS
Effective problem-solving skill is the ability to identify a problem and then come up with several possible solutions. Along with this, critical thinking skills are also essential for the person engaged in careers in physical education. These skills allow you to evaluate each possible solution using logic to determine which one is most likely to succeed.
7) EFFECTIVE FLEXIBILITY AND ADAPTABILITY
Effective flexibility and adaptability are significant soft skills for physical education careers and other career domains. It is a fact that people who are flexible and adaptable react well to changes in their jobs. Such persons have a positive 'can-do attitude. They adjust themselves according to the circumstances easily. They are also able to bounce back after a disappointment. They continue to move forward and upward.

9) EFFECTIVE CONTROL OVER EMOTIONS
Persons engaged in careers related to physical education should have effective control over emotions, especially negative ones such as anger, frustration, embarrassment, etc. If they have good control over emotions, they can think clearly, objectively and act accordingly.
